Welcome to eujust-themis Primary or elementary education
consists of the first years of formal, structured education
that occur during childhood. In most countries, it is
compulsory for children to receive primary education (though
in many jurisdictions it is permissible for parents to
provide it). Primary education generally begins when
children are four to eight years of age.Higher education,
also called tertiary, third stage or post secondary
education, often known as academia, is the non-compulsory
educational level following the completion of a school
providing a secondary education, such as a high school,
secondary school, or gymnasium. In most contemporary
educational systems of the world, secondary education
consists of the second years of formal education that occur
during adolescence. Education as a science cannot be
